The One About Christ-Centered Preaching (with special guest Jared C. Wilson) show art The One About Christ-Centered Preaching (with special guest Jared C. Wilson)

Talks On The Road

Season 7 of Talks on the Road is here! In our first episode, Pastor Matt sits down with author and pastor Jared C. Wilson to talk about the church, the church-growth movement, and the importance of keeping Christ at the center of the church’s ministry. Together, they discuss the seeker-sensitive movement, lessons the church can learn from it, and why faithful, Christ-centered preaching matters. Rather than simply offering practical advice or principles for a better life, biblical preaching should continually point people to the person and work of Jesus Christ and the good news of the gospel....

Unsaid on Sunday: Genesis 37-38 show art Unsaid on Sunday: Genesis 37-38

Talks On The Road

Sunday’s sermon covered Genesis 37 and 38. In this week’s Unsaid on Sunday, Pastor Matt explains why these two chapters must be read side by side. Though they may seem like two very different passages, they work together to show us how God is sovereignly at work in both suffering and sin. Listen today as Pastor Matt unpacks how these chapters go hand in hand.
